#18 - The Mitzvah of Learning/Teaching Torah
from Climb Sinai: The Big Ideas of Judaism · host Rabbi Jack Cohen EdM
Based on Mishnah Torah I: Book of Knowledge, the Laws of Torah Study, Ch. 1 Why is there a separate mitzvah to study Torah? Isn't it assumed that we'll know the law to keep the law? To what extent do we have to teach Torah to others? Torah study is the heart and soul of Judaism, but why? In the words of Rabbi Shlomo Freifeld zt"l: "Religious observance is personal, but ignorance is treason." Not knowing is tantamount to not teaching or mis-teaching.
